Former MHK reacts to Laxey floods
A former infrastructure minister believes the Island's roads and drains aren't designed to cope with the level of rainfall recently seen in Laxey.
Phil Gawne, who now serves as clerk for Rushen and Arbory Commissioners, spoke about the damage at Glen Road while appearing on the Mannin Line this lunchtime.
